The PowerSchool Parent Portal allows parents, guardians, and other appropriate individuals to view different types of student information as it is entered into the student information system.
The type of information that is available varies by school level (elementary, middle, and high). Information may include: school announcements, attendance, grades, schedules, and lunch balances.
The portal may also be used by parents and students to manage course requests for middle and high school. For more information about the parent portal and exactly which types of information are available, please contact your child’s school.
The Schoology Parent Portal allows parents, guardians, and other appropriate individuals of middle and high school students to view assignments and student feedback as it is entered into the learning management system for secondary schools.
The Schoology username/email for parent accounts is the email address you used when creating your PowerSchool parent portal account. If you change the email address associated to the PowerSchool parent portal account, the Schoology username/email does not change.
Are you using the correct password?
The default password found in the PowerSchool parent portal for your Schoology account was used to establish your Schoology parent account. If you change the password once you log in to your Schoology parent account (this is recommended), then the default password found in the PowerSchool parent portal will not work. You can always use the Forgot your password link on the Schoology login page to reset your password.
Did you recently create your PowerSchool parent portal account?
It can take 24-48 hours after you create your PowerSchool parent portal account for your Schoology parent account to become active.
If you have questions about the content in Schoology, contact your student’s teacher. If you still have trouble accessing your Schoology account after trying the suggestions above, contact the ACPS Dept. of Technology Help Desk at 434-975-9444.
Seesaw Parent Access allows parents, guardians, and other appropriate individuals of elementary students to view assignments and student feedback as it is entered into the learning management system for elementary schools.
SchooLinks is a modern, college and career readiness platform to prepare students for what comes after graduation. SchooLinks helps students discover their interests and strengths, explore colleges and careers, and create an individualized career and academic plan that best reflects their post-secondary goals. SchooLinks at Albemarle County is accessible in 6th-12th grades by students and their parents.
